Quoted from nighttaco:

Is it totally impossible to finish code on this?

I would say no, but it goes beyond the code. There are mechanical, layout, missing parts, other issues as well. It would take significant work to make one truly playable.

Quoted from PinLen83:

It's a shame when you come on here to share what I consider an ABSOLUTE majestic work of art in motion that you become lambasted by those who probably wish they had an OUNCE of what you've been so blessed to have.

Nobody is dumping on this out of jealousy. They're dumping on it because it's the product of the hard work of dozens of people who were lied to, used for their abilities and left owed thousands and thousands of dollars of unpaid invoices.

Celebrating this game, which doesn't work, has a bunch of broken or missing parts, and is made of essentially STOLEN property would only go to validate the crimes that John Popadiuk is guilty of, and that shouldn't happen.

Also it's highly insulting to the people involved to just say "oh we'll just finish that work" when the work that's there wasn't paid for.
